    Caring staff but poor oversight

    I have mixed feelings. The caregivers are often warm and the rehab/activities program is excellent - my mom improved and enjoyed outings - but staff are clearly overworked and underpaid. Long shifts, phones and chatting instead of attending residents, and hour-long waits for bathroom help led to neglectful episodes. Cleanliness and infection control were inconsistent (strong urine smell, filthy areas, COVID handling lapses). Management/HR communication and billing were poor - insurance and payment issues, unresponsive leadership, and I even reported concerns to the health department. I appreciate the caring staff, but I cannot recommend the facility until staffing, cleanliness, and oversight improve.

    About Mountain View Care Center

    Mountain View Care and Rehabilitation Center is a large, for-profit nursing facility located in a corporate setting, with a capacity to accommodate up to 180 residents. This facility provides both short-term rehabilitation and long-term care, and it participates in both Medicare and Medicaid programs, making it accessible to a broad range of individuals who require skilled nursing or extended care services. While it is not part of a continuing care retirement community, Mountain View Care and Rehabilitation Center offers comprehensive support for those recovering from hospital stays as well as individuals in need of ongoing daily assistance.

    The center focuses on fostering an environment where residents who require medical supervision, rehabilitation therapies, and support with daily activities can receive consistent levels of care. Nursing staff provide an average of 3 hours and 41 minutes of care per resident each day, a measure that includes attention to both weekday and weekend staffing patterns, ensuring residents' needs are met with consistency. The staff supports residents with activities such as dressing, eating, using the bathroom, and other basic self-care tasks. A notably high percentage of residents, 92.8%, are able to maintain their ability to move, feed themselves, use the restroom, and manage common daily functions independently. Additionally, the facility places importance on preventive health measures, as demonstrated by the 95% flu vaccination rate among residents.

    Mountain View Care and Rehabilitation Center offers rehabilitation services designed for those recovering from illnesses or injuries such as stroke, heart attack, infections, or accidental injuries. Residents in short-term rehabilitation have access to the therapies and support needed to facilitate their recovery with the aim of returning safely home; approximately 27.5% of those discharged were able to return home. The staff maintains vigilance for safety, working to minimize falls and major injuries, resulting in a relatively low incidence of such events. The percentage of residents who experienced falls resulting in major injury was 0.9%, while 7.6% of short-term rehab stays involved serious infections necessitating hospitalization. Emergency care remains readily available, with 11.3% of short-term residents requiring emergency room visits during their stay.
